2020
09-24
09-24
python多维数组分位数的求取方式
在python中计算一个多维数组的任意百分比分位数,只需用np.percentile即可,十分方便importnumpyasnpa=[154,400,1124,82,94,108]printnp.percentile(a,95)#givesthe95thpercentile补充拓展:如何解决hive同时计算多个分位数的问题众所周知,原生hive没有计算中位数的函数(有的平台会有),只有计算分位数的函数percentile在数据量不大的时候,速度尚可。但是数据量一上来之后,完全计算不出来。那么如何解决这个问...
继续阅读 >